Might be of interest to those that want a mostly ready made MiniPC/NUC that seems to straddle both camps and has ultra low power usage.
Limited sale price at the moment.
Onda M2 Mini PC - SILVER
Intel Pentium J1900 Quad Core CPU
4GB RAM
128GB SATA 3 SSD
3 x USB 2
1 x USB 3
1 x HDMI
1 x VGA
100Mb LAN (RTL8168E)
Dual Band WiFi
Realtek ALC662 5.1 Sound
External WiFi antenna
Add your own OS
14x14x3cm, so very small form factor.
5v2a AC.
Aluminium shell

Unfortunately this is common practice for Chinese/Hong Kong based companies. FocalPoint and DealExtreme do it as well. I've personally caught both of those doing it; e.g. 5 star reviews, all in the same poor English, for products that have just been added to the catalog but aren't available to ship yet!
There are also companies who will post blocks of reviews for iPhone/Android apps so you' shouldn't necessarily trust those either!
